A leading startup incubator in the UK is looking for ambitious entrepreneurs to build and scale their startups. You will receive a salary while building your company, or opt for funding up to 500k. Join us for 1:1 coaching from successful unicorn founders, access to a network of over 50,000 professionals, and support to achieve product-market fit. This role is freelance and requires excellent English communication skills while taking full responsibility for scaling your startup.

How to prepare for a job interview at EWOR GmbH

Know Your Vision

Before the interview, take some time to clearly define your vision for the startup you want to build. Be ready to articulate how your ideas align with the incubator's goals and how you plan to achieve product-market fit.

Showcase Your Entrepreneurial Spirit

Demonstrate your passion for entrepreneurship by sharing past experiences where you've taken initiative or led projects. Highlight any relevant successes or lessons learned that showcase your ability to scale a business.

Prepare for Tough Questions

Expect challenging questions about your business model, market research, and competition. Prepare thoughtful responses that reflect your understanding of the industry and your strategic approach to overcoming obstacles.

Engage with the Network

Familiarise yourself with the incubator's network and be prepared to discuss how you can leverage these connections. Mention specific professionals or resources that could help you in your journey, showing that you're proactive and well-informed.
